Heart Disease Prediction Using Ensemble Techniques and Explainable AI Validation

Cardiovascular diseases (CVD) pose a global threat, with mortality projected to reach 23.3 million by 2030. This paper presents a comprehensive approach to designing a system aimed at leveraging machine learning and Explainable AI (XAI) techniques for the development of a reliable and interpretable predictive model for coronary artery disease (CAD). The primary objective encompasses both the construction of predictive models and the utilization of SHAP (SHapley Additive exPlanations) Analysis to enhance model interpretability. Through meticulous system design, we evaluate various machine learning algorithms to identify the most effective model for CAD prediction. Following model selection, SHAP Analysis is employed to elucidate the impact of different features on model predictions, thereby facilitating a deeper understanding of the underlying mechanisms driving CAD classification. This study underscores the importance of not only predictive accuracy but also interpretability in medical decision-making processes.
